#WritersCoffeeClub #WCC 2026.01.03 — How do you come up with the titles for your works?

Usually, something about the story pops up that feels right.

For example, I named Inklings by serendipity. The POV does magic that leaves picture-like scars that resemble tattoos, and she meets a Pacific Islander (LI) who is covered with tattoos, rare where the story takes place. He's surprised upon noticing one of her scars (blue feathers) and tells her she has "ink." At some point in the story, I wrote the word inkling in the sense of a thought. Hearing the word, my mind shot to a new meaning for the word: a person who had "ink," thus the romance story between the two characters became the titled Inklings."
